Course Details
• Advanced Tree Pathology: This unit will cover the detailed study of tree pathology, focusing on the causes and effects of various diseases on tree health.
• Identification and Diagnosis of Tree Diseases: In this unit, students will learn how to identify and diagnose different types of tree diseases using various tools and techniques.
• Fungal and Bacterial Tree Diseases: This unit will focus specifically on fungal and bacterial diseases that affect trees, their symptoms, and control measures.
• Viral Tree Diseases: This unit will cover the diagnosis and management of viral diseases that affect trees.
• Tree Disease Management: This unit will teach students how to manage and control tree diseases using various cultural, chemical, and biological methods.
• Environmental Factors Contributing to Tree Diseases: In this unit, students will learn about the environmental factors that contribute to tree diseases and how to mitigate their impact.
• Tree Disease Epidemiology: This unit will cover the study of tree disease epidemiology, including the spread, distribution, and control of tree diseases.
• Tree Disease Monitoring and Surveillance: This unit will teach students how to monitor and surveil tree health to detect and respond to tree diseases in a timely manner.
• Tree Disease and Climate Change: This unit will explore the impact of climate change on tree diseases and the strategies that can be used to adapt to and mitigate these impacts.
